Cyber threat intelligence using AI

Cyber Threat Intelligence (CTI) has become a critical component of modern cybersecurity by enabling organizations to proactively identify, analyze, and mitigate emerging cyber threats. The growing volume, diversity, and sophistication of cyberattacks—including ransomware, Advanced Persistent Threats (APTs), phishing campaigns, zero-day exploits, supply chain compromises, and AI-enabled attacks—have made traditional threat analysis methods increasingly inadequate. Artificial Intelligence (AI), particularly machine learning, deep learning, natural language processing (NLP), large language models (LLMs), and graph-based analytics, is transforming cyber threat intelligence by automating threat detection, accelerating intelligence analysis, correlating heterogeneous data sources, and enabling predictive threat assessment. AI-powered CTI enhances situational awareness, improves decision-making, and strengthens the ability of organizations to anticipate and respond to evolving cyber threats.
